Freight Cost Analytics &
- Optimization
- Develop robust freight cost models, including per/KM and per/KG cost analysis, across lanes, modes, & geographies.
- Identify key cost drivers and implement initiatives to reduce freight costs and improve efficiency.
- Conduct variance analysis, vendor benchmarking, and route optimization studies.
- Support commercial and procurement teams with cost insights for negotiations.
Freight Governance &
- Compliance
- Establish and drive freight governance frameworks across regions.
- Ensure adherence to defined transportation policies, rate cards, and contractual terms.
- Monitor and control freight spend with structured governance mechanisms.
- Drive transparency, accountability, and standardization in logistics operations.
SOP Development &
- Process Standardization
- Create, implement and optimse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) for logistics processes.
- Ensure SOP adherence across countries and stakeholders.
- Standardize logistics practices to drive consistency, efficiency, and scalability.
- Lead regular process audits and identify areas for improvement.
Multi-Country Logistics Operations
- Analyze and support logistics operations across multiple countries/regions.
- Collaborate with regional teams to streamline transportation networks and processes.
- Ensure optimization of cross-border logistics with respect to cost, timelines,
and service levels.
Efficiency &
- Continuous Improvement
- Drive process improvement initiatives focused on route optimization, load utilization, and turnaround times.
- Identify automation opportunities to enhance logistics efficiency and reduce manual intervention.
- Lead cross-functional projects to improve supply chain performance.
Data Analytics &
- Reporting
- Build and maintain dashboards using Excel, Power BI, Tableau, or similar tools.
- Deliver actionable insights through deep-dive analysis of logistics and transportation data.
- Improve data accuracy, availability, and reporting automation.
Stakeholder Management
- Collaborate with Supply Chain, Procurement, Finance, and Regional Teams to drive logistics performance.
- Influence decision-making through data-backed recommendations and transparent communication.
- Support leadership with insights on cost trends and efficiency opportunities.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)
- Reduction in freight cost per KM
- Overall freight cost savings vs baseline/budget
- Improvement in logistics efficiency metrics (load utilization, route optimization, turnaround time)
- SOP adherence and governance compliance levels
- Successful implementation of process improvement initiatives
- Data accuracy and dashboard adoption
